No traffic touring cycling routes around Torremocha Del Pinar are primarily found within the Alto Tajo Natural Park, a region characterized by dramatic canyons and gorges carved by the Tagus River and its tributaries. The landscape features extensive pine and sabina forests, alongside river valleys like that of the Arandilla River, which flows through the Montesinos ravine. The area offers a network of forest tracks and secondary roads, providing varied terrain suitable for touring cycling.

This is undoubtedly one of the Tagus's great wonders. Crossing the beautiful river on a suspension bridge like this one, where motor vehicles are prohibited, reduces the number of crossing options. Walkers and cyclists can enjoy the oscillating motion experienced by the bridge's anchorage. Absolutely recommended!

Are there any specific natural features or unique ecosystems to look out for?

Absolutely. The region is home to the 'Prados Húmedos' micro-reserve in Torremocha del Pinar, known for unique plant species like the rare Ophioglossum azoricum fern and various moisture-loving communities. While not a direct cycling path, it highlights the rich biodiversity nearby. You'll also find ancient juniper forests, locally known as 'El Sabinar', offering a distinct natural charm.

Are there any Vías Verdes (greenways) near Torremocha del Pinar suitable for cycling?

While Torremocha del Pinar itself is not directly on a Vía Verde, the concept of car-free routes is central to the area's appeal, with many forest tracks and secondary roads offering low-traffic cycling. The Vía Verde del Tajuña is a well-known greenway in the broader Guadalajara province, which could be considered for a separate trip if you're looking for dedicated car-free paths.
